EK03 DAN is a 2003 Jeep Grand Cherokee 4.0 Ltd A in Blue with a 3,956c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 25 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 76%.

Across all 2003 Jeep Grand Cherokee 4.0 Ltd A models, the average MOT pass rate is 75.5% with a typical mileage of 83,088 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Jeep Grand Cherokee 4.0 Ltd A f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 53 recorded failures. If you're considering buying EK03 DAN,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Jeep Grand Cherokee 4.0 Ltd A typically stays on UK roads for around 23 years. At 23 years old, this Jeep Grand Cherokee 4.0 Ltd A is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
